Transaction bbda87aacbc20f7dafb7311605565f6baa47c89b92d40d0dc0988695e4118f5a
1 Input
1 Output
-
bbda87aacbc20f7dafb7311605565f6baa47c89b92d40d0dc0988695e4118f5a:0
- value
- 958950
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 48f3af3e9f5b11dc046c00f3fc09c2ba587b0f9306781111d94dcba934433642
- address
- bc1pfre6705ltvgacprvqrelczwzhfv8krunqeupzywefh96jdzrxepqjet4lp